To some extend, yes.Quote:
Originally posted by Livy@3 February 2004 - 00:37
does anyone know if its possible o choose what wu u download.
In the config-screen you can choose:
Genome@Home
Folding@Home
or no preference.
When you choose Folding@home you get mostly (or all) tinkers without any switches.
Adding the "-advmethods" switch will get you mostly Gromacs (when available)
Then there is a possibility to join the 'beta-team'.
Then you'll get to test the newest WUs.
Perhaps it's possible to configure your firewall in such a way that your machine can't establish a connection with the server(s) that hand out the WUs you don't want.
